The Romans created a sewer system to move waste and waste matter far from their ancient capital city now called Rome, Italy. This intricate drain system began as an open air canal constructed by the Etruscans. The Romans gradually developed over the outdoors canal and changed the Cloaca Maxima right into a protected sewer system.

Some components of the Cloaca Maxima are still being used to this extremely day.
